What's the walk about?

Welcome to Park Sanssouci, the sprawling UNESCO World Heritage park where Frederick the Great built his retreat 'without a care' and where three generations of Prussian kings kept adding palaces, temples, and gardens. On this clockwise loop we begin at the colossal Neues Palais, wander east past the gilded Chinese House and Schinkel's Italian Roman Baths to the lakeside Church of Peace, then return west along the northern ridge: the Picture Gallery, the famous vineyard terraces of Sanssouci Palace, the Historic Windmill, the Orangery Palace, and finally the Belvedere on the Klausberg and its whimsical Dragon House. Along the way you'll meet Voltaire, a stubborn miller, a beloved sister, and a king who asked to be buried beside his dogs.
